Show "GIKLS' DAY" TO BE OBSERVED AT HIGH SCHOOL Today, Friduy, is "Girls' Day" at the Milford High School. Regular classes will be held in the 'forenoon, with an assembly scheduled for 2:30 p. m., at which the Home Economics girls will entertain en-tertain their mothers at a tea and fashion show. Work done by the Home Economics girls during the year will be exhibited. In the evening the Tigerettes will sponsor a dance in the High School gymnasium. The hall is beino- attractively decorated for the occasion, and highlight of the evening wil be the crowning of a "king," to be chosen Ifrom Ray Kes-ler, Kes-ler, Howard Bingham, Arnold Swindlehurst and Bud Zabriskie. |
